Mandala isn’t simply an art form, it is touted as a representative of the entire universe by Buddhists and Hindus. It means a ‘circle’ or ‘completion’ in Sanskrit, and has always been used as an ...
Buddhist monks from Tibet visited San Luis Obispo County this week to create a colorful - and temporary - sand mandala.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results